Action item from the Cartwheel checkout incident: plugin authors must respect the shared load-test budget. Exceeding connection or request ceilings during a test window skews results for everyone and delayed our root-cause analysis by two days. Please validate your plugin against the enforced constants, which are listed immediately below.

tuning constants:
QUOTAS = {
    "druwyn": 5,
    "holix": 5,
    "zorath": 5,
    "holwyn": 10,
}

Minutes — Management Meeting, Pellmore Coffee Houses

Attendees: regional leads, operations, legal.

Franchise agreement with Holt & Brannigan approved in principle. Royalty set at 5%; territory limited to the Westmarch corridor. Branch managers to brief staff only after signing. Training schedule circulates next week. No press contact until launch. Confidential business-planning note follows below.

confidential, baweg-tahop: The steering committee signed off on a budget of $1.4 million for Project Gordor. The renewal with Elioxix Holdings closes at $31.7 million a year, 60 percent below the last contract.

Subject: Handover — Conveyor queue migration

Hi folks, welcome aboard. Quick context: we're retiring the homegrown job queue ("Stackline") in favor of the new Conveyor service. Stackline still runs the nightly exports, so don't decommission it until Conveyor's retry logic clears soak testing next sprint. Deploys to Conveyor go through the usual pipeline, but note it verifies every worker image signature before rollout. The deploy key the pipeline expects is the one right here.

release key, kawif-hawep: bky13_X7TGuRG4Zu4ZJ

If the Quillstack queue-depth autoscaler fails to scale within two evaluation cycles, page the platform rotation and capture the scaler's decision log before any manual intervention. Do not adjust replica counts directly; record the queue depth, scaler state, and timestamps for the review packet. For escalation beyond the rotation, contact the autoscaler service owner.

escalation mailbox, kadup-fajof: ulador@qirvanlabs.corp